The Issue
We the undersigned petition Brent Council to resolve the issue of unacceptable amounts of rubbish being dumped on our streets. The dumped rubbish is anti-social, it causes potential health hazards by attracting rats and other vermin to our streets and it affects the well-being of responsible residents, whilst making the area unwelcoming to visitors.
We call on Brent Council to implement the following 6 point plan to clean up Wembley Central:
1. We call on Brent Council to put in place measures which prevent rubbish being dumped on our streets and to fully publicise what these measures are.
2. We call on Brent Council to strongly enforce existing laws and regulations against those who litter, those who dump rubbish/fly-tip and those who do not manage their waste properly on private land.
3. We call on Brent Council to raise awareness of this problem, stressing that it will no longer be tolerated, through an education program including posters and leafleting, whilst engaging with local landlords, businesses, schools, colleges and places of worship.
4. We call on Brent Council to respond to genuine complaints from residents in a timely and respectful manner.
5. We call on Brent Council to pro-actively combat the effects of recent multi-occupancy housing on the existing local community. Each landlord licence would generate £400 per property. This income must be invested to regulate and enforce regulations.
6. We call on Brent Council to issue financial penalties against Veolia where the service fails to meet the required standard.
For too long the Council have ignored our complaints about rubbish in our area and they need to take immediate and long term action to solve this problem.
